随着互联网的飞速发展,视频已经成为了人们获取信息、娱乐和学习的重要途径。因此,建立一个自己的视频网站不仅可以展示个人或企业的视频内容,还可以为用户提供一个便捷的观看平台。本文将为您提供一份详细的教程,帮助您从零开始建立一个属于自己的视频网站。

一、确定网站目标和需求

在开始建设视频网站之前,您需要明确您的网站目标和需求。例如,您的网站是为了分享个人生活点滴,还是为了发布企业产品宣传视频?您希望用户能够上传自己的视频,还是只允许管理员上传?这些问题将决定您网站的结构和功能。

二、选择合适的网站建设平台

根据您的需求,您可以选择以下几种方式来建设视频网站:

  1. 自建服务器:如果您对技术有一定了解,可以选择自己搭建服务器,购买域名和空间,然后安装视频网站程序。这种方式的优点是灵活性高,但缺点是成本较高,且需要一定的技术支持。

  2. 使用开源视频网站系统:如WordPress、Drupal等,这些系统提供了丰富的插件和模板,可以帮助您快速搭建一个视频网站。这种方式的优点是成本低,易于维护;缺点是可能需要一定的技术基础来进行定制开发。

  3. 使用云服务提供商:如阿里云、腾讯云等,这些服务提供商提供了一站式的视频网站解决方案,包括域名注册、空间租赁、视频编码转换等服务。这种方式的优点是简单易用,适合没有技术背景的用户;缺点是成本相对较高。

三、设计网站结构和界面

在选择了合适的网站建设平台后,您需要设计网站的结构和界面。这包括以下几个方面:

  1. 网站导航:设计清晰的导航栏,让用户能够快速找到他们想要的内容。

  2. 首页布局:根据网站的目标和需求,设计吸引人的首页布局,展示热门视频或推荐内容。

  3. 视频分类:为不同类型的视频设置分类标签,方便用户浏览和搜索。

  4. 用户注册与登录:如果允许用户上传视频或评论,需要设计用户注册与登录功能。

  5. 响应式设计:确保网站在不同设备(如电脑、手机、平板)上都能良好显示。

四、编写和测试网站代码

如果您选择自建服务器或使用开源系统进行定制开发,您需要编写相应的网站代码。这包括前端页面的HTML、CSS和JavaScript代码,以及后端服务器的PHP、Python或其他语言的代码。在完成代码编写后,您需要进行充分的测试,确保网站的功能正常且性能良好。

五、发布和维护网站

在完成网站的设计、开发和测试后,您可以将网站发布到互联网上。发布前请确保备份好所有数据,以防万一出现意外情况。发布后,您需要定期更新内容、优化性能并进行维护工作,以保证网站的稳定运行和用户体验。